接口的使用
org.springframework.web.server.session.WebSessionManager
使用WebSessionManager的程序包 程序包 说明 org.springframework.mock.web.server Mock implementations of Spring's reactive server web API abstractions.org.springframework.test.web.reactive.server Support for testing Spring WebFlux server endpoints viaWebTestClient
.org.springframework.web.server.adapter Implementations to adapt to the underlyingorg.springframework.http.client.reactive
reactive HTTP adapter andHttpHandler
.org.springframework.web.server.session Auxiliary interfaces and implementation classes forWebSession
support.org.springframework.mock.web.server中WebSessionManager的使用
参数类型为WebSessionManager的org.springframework.mock.web.server中的方法 修饰符和类型 方法 说明 MockServerWebExchange.Builder
MockServerWebExchange.Builder. sessionManager(WebSessionManager sessionManager)
Provide aWebSessionManager
instance to use with the exchange.org.springframework.test.web.reactive.server中WebSessionManager的使用
参数类型为WebSessionManager的org.springframework.test.web.reactive.server中的方法 修饰符和类型 方法 说明 <T extends B>
TWebTestClient.MockServerSpec. webSessionManager(WebSessionManager sessionManager)
Provide a session manager instance for the mock server.org.springframework.web.server.adapter中WebSessionManager的使用
返回WebSessionManager的org.springframework.web.server.adapter中的方法 修饰符和类型 方法 说明 WebSessionManager
HttpWebHandlerAdapter. getSessionManager()
Return the configuredWebSessionManager
.参数类型为WebSessionManager的org.springframework.web.server.adapter中的方法 修饰符和类型 方法 说明 WebHttpHandlerBuilder
WebHttpHandlerBuilder. sessionManager(WebSessionManager manager)
Configure theWebSessionManager
to set on theWebServerExchange
.void
HttpWebHandlerAdapter. setSessionManager(WebSessionManager sessionManager)
Configure a customWebSessionManager
to use for managing web sessions.参数类型为WebSessionManager的org.springframework.web.server.adapter中的构造器 构造器 说明 DefaultServerWebExchange(ServerHttpRequest request, ServerHttpResponse response, WebSessionManager sessionManager, ServerCodecConfigurer codecConfigurer, LocaleContextResolver localeContextResolver)
org.springframework.web.server.session中WebSessionManager的使用
实现WebSessionManager的org.springframework.web.server.session中的类 修饰符和类型 类 说明 class
DefaultWebSessionManager
Default implementation ofWebSessionManager
delegating to aWebSessionIdResolver
for session id resolution and to aWebSessionStore
.